Making most of physical deformity
Anwar Al-Sayed | Arab News
 

MINA: Beggars, especially those from African countries, use their deformities to beg from the pilgrims who are always ready to give seeking Allah’s reward in these blessed days. They have organized themselves in long queues which gives the impression that this not just a random work but a planned one.

Near Jamrat Bridge in Mina at least 30 men and women were seen extending their hands to the pilgrims asking charity. Every one of them had a deformity of one kind or other. They included the blind, the handicapped and young women carrying their young babies.

Beggars, especially those from sub-Saharan Africa, prefer to use their deformities to gain the sympathy of others while beggars coming from North African countries ask for money to buy medicines or food. Beggars from Middle Eastern countries tend to tell dramatic stories about losing their belongings, including their passport, tickets and money.

The anti-beggary office in Makkah is continuously asking citizens and expatriates not to give money to these beggars. The office organizes periodic campaigns to round up these people but it seems no one cares.

Beggars are seen almost everywhere in the holy sites and they employ various tactics to gain sympathy of unsuspecting pilgrims.
